Pool Fence Regulations Hingham MA Understanding Pool Fence Regulations

Comprehending pool fence laws is crucial for ensuring the safety of your swimming area. These regulations are designed to prevent accidents and enhance security, particularly for families with young children and pets. By following these regulations, you can maintain a secure and compliant pool space.

- Height and Material Standards: One of the primary aspects of pool fence regulations is height and material requirements. Most guidelines mandate that pool fences must be at least four feet high to stop young kids from entering the pool area. The fence should be built from robust materials such as metal, vinyl, or wood, ensuring it can withstand weather conditions and provide long-lasting security. Mesh fences are also widely used because they are climb-resistant and difficult for children to breach.

- Gate and Latch Standards: Another vital part of pool fence guidelines is the standards for gates and latches. Gates should be self-closing and self-latching to ensure they close and lock automatically. The latch should be positioned out of the reach of young children, usually at least 54 inches high. This setup prevents children from opening the gate and gaining access to the pool area. Furthermore, gates need to open outward away from the swimming area, to prevent children from pushing them open and entering the pool.

Adhering to Regulations and Increasing Safety

Ensuring compliance with pool fence regulations not only boosts safety but also guards you from legal complications. Consistently inspecting your fence and making necessary repairs ensures it stays effective and compliant.

- Regular Inspections and Maintenance: To ensure your pool fence remains compliant and effective, consistent inspections and maintenance are vital. Check for any damage or wear that could affect the fence's integrity. Loose posts, broken latches, or rusted components should be repaired or replaced immediately to keep the fence secure. Routine maintenance helps extend the life of your fence and maintains its compliance with safety standards.

- Upgrading to Meet New Standards: Pool fence regulations can evolve, so it's important to stay informed about new requirements. Modernizing your pool fence to adhere to new guidelines ensures continued compliance and boosts safety. This might involve installing new self-closing gates, adding more locks, or reinforcing existing parts. By taking proactive steps, you can ensure your pool remains a safe and enjoyable space for everyone.
